Types of Intellectual Property
Patents
Legal rights granted for inventions to exclude others from usage.
Designs
Protection of shape, pattern, and visual features of products.
Trademarks
Symbols or names used to distinguish goods/services.
Copyrights
Rights for literary, artistic, and creative works.
Geographical Indications
Products linked to specific geographical origin.
Plant Variety Protection
Protection for plant breeders and new varieties.
Semiconductor Layout Design
Protection for IC layout designs.
